ProFTPd and NIS problems
Before I shoot of a bug report to the ProFTPd guys, I was wondering if
any of you have run into this one before. We're using ProFTPd
Version 1.2.0pre10, and I've experienced this problem with both the
2.0 and 2.1 packages.
Some users, all users are authenticated via NIS, cannot list the
contents of their home directories. They can manipulate any file in
the directory as long as they know what the name of the file is, but
the list function fails. This is a very consistent issue that spans
the userbase and multiple groups. I can't quite find a pattern.
We do use netgroups and NIS distributed passwd/group files. Home
directories are automounted from a network file server.
Any ideas?
